3. Who were the Indiana Pacers playing in the "Big Brawl Game" in the 2004 season?

Explanation

In the "Big Brawl Game" in the 2004 season, the Indiana Pacers were playing against the Detroit Pistons. This game is infamous for the massive fight that broke out between players and fans, resulting in multiple suspensions and fines.
